THESE HEARTACHES-- DENA BARNES --northern soul...
THESE HEARTACHES-- DENA BARNES --northern soul...
2,026 views
v99nda said:
This isn't Dena Barnes. It's a taylor-made recording created by Simon Soussan in the mid 70's dubbing over the original Duke Browner (Kadoo Strings) backing. To my knowledge it's rarely, if ever played now.
Having said that,I do like it.
